The back-end review of online novels usually used a series of technical means to determine whether the novel was plagiarized, including but not limited to the following: 1. Text analysis: The reviewers will analyze the novel's text, including keyword analysis, sentence structure analysis, grammar analysis, etc., to determine whether the novel comes from other works or directly copy and paste. If the novel had a lot of similarities or similar plots and character settings, it might be plagiarism. The platform also uses similarity detection technology to compare novels with existing works to detect if there are a lot of similarities. The similarity test could be done through algorithms and manual review. If the similarity was very high, it might be suspected of plagiarism. 3. Citation check: The reviewers will check if the novel has any references to other works. If there is, they must conduct a reference check to determine if the references are legal. 4. copyright information: reviewers will check the copyright information of the novel to determine whether the novel violates the copyright of existing works. If the copyright information of the novel is unclear or the use of other people's works without authorization may be suspected of plagiarism. 5. Manual review: At the end, the reviewers will conduct a manual review to carefully analyze and judge the novel. Although there might be misjudgments in manual review, the platform usually used a variety of technical methods combined with manual review to determine whether the novel was plagiarized. It was important to note that the background review of online novels was not omnipotent. There could also be misjudgments.
